Job Overview
This is a specialist SLT post primarily based in the Transforming Care autism team (TCAT) and working into the Neurodevelopmental service diagnostic service as required by the principal SLT for the neurodevelopmental service. The post holder will play a core role in the MDT team consisting of OTs, clinical psychologists, therapy assistants and peer support workers who work with autistic adults and young people from 14 years old who do not have a learning disability. The team criteria is to provide specialist assessment and consultation regarding people who are on the Dynamic support register, and who are therefore inpatients or at imminent risk of requiring inpatient admission.
The SLT will assess, formulate and make recommendations regarding how a shared understanding of the person's communication needs will contribute to understanding and reducing the presenting risk. The SLT will offer advice and support to enable the person and their support system to live well with their neurodivergence and reduce risk of future hospital admission.
Detailed Job Description And Main Responsibilities
To provide a highly specialist Speech and Language Therapy service to autistic people who are on the Transforming Care Risk Register as part of TCAT in order to support discharge or avoid admission.
To provide specialist assessment and contribute to differential diagnosis in the NDS as required by the Principal SLT NDS.
To provide highly specialist supervision to other Speech and Language Therapists or Speech and Language Therapy Assistants within Sussex Partnership NHS Foundation Trust as necessary.
Work in collaboration with multidisciplinary colleagues and other agencies.
